Teaching as an Adjunct Instructor
If you are interested in teaching in a university setting, it can be helpful to gain experience as an adjunct instructor. Many of our adjunct instructors hold a full-time career elsewhere, and choose to teach in our evening, weekend, and online programs so that they may have the opportunity to teach students.
The University has an academic coordinator/academic dean at each campus location. This individual is dedicated to hiring for adjunct teaching responsibilities. Adjunct Instructors are hired to teach on a per course basis. Each academic term may present the need to hire new or additional adjunct instructors.
